5 Tips for Replacing Your Windows

Working to ensure the strength and durability of your home is always important. Of course, various components of your home may need to be replaced, and one of these are your windows. Taking the necessary time to know tips that can help you during this process are ideal.

Tip #1: Consider extra panes

Of course, you will have some choices when it comes to the replacement of your windows. These do come in a variety of types, and you will want to select the right kind.

One thing you should strongly consider involves selecting triple paned windows. This can decrease your energy costs and enable you to enjoy a more comfortable home because of the additional layer of insulation.

Tip #2: Practice safety

When working with glass, you will want to practice as much safety as possible. Be sure to be careful when installing the windows to avoid any breakage that could translate to a potential injury.

Tip #3: Ask for assistance

You may want to have a friend help you with the installation of the windows. This can enable you to have an easier time putting these in place and can allow you to get the job done in a shorter amount of time.

Tip #4: Measure correctly

You will want to use a tape measure to help you get the accurate measurements when it comes to the replacement of windows in your home. The last thing you will want to do is get windows that won't fit after you've made this purchase.

Additionally, ill-fitting windows can create a lot of issues in your home, and one of these is letting too much of the hot or cold outside air into your home.

Tip #5: Use proper flashing

To get the best results for this home improvement job, it is necessary to rely on the right type of flashing. Windows do have the potential of leaking at the top, and you will want to use a flip cap to help reduce the chances of this occurring.

The benefits of working to complete this task include having a home that is more insulated and one that has an increased value.
